I18n: Migrate to I18next (#55845)

* Switch from lingui from i18next

* Change lingui messages to i18next messages

* Change lingui messages to i18next messages (grafana-ui)

* Init i18n for tests
This commit is contained in:
Josh Hunt
2022-10-06 16:34:04 +01:00
committed by GitHub
parent c1d6df4eb7
commit 5361efc225
58 changed files with 2557 additions and 4364 deletions

View File

@@ -1,7 +1,7 @@
import { Trans } from '@lingui/macro';
import React from 'react';
import { DataSourceApi, PanelData } from '@grafana/data';
import { Trans } from 'app/core/internationalization';
interface InspectMetadataTabProps {
data: PanelData;
@@ -9,7 +9,7 @@ interface InspectMetadataTabProps {
}
export const InspectMetadataTab: React.FC<InspectMetadataTabProps> = ({ data, metadataDatasource }) => {
if (!metadataDatasource || !metadataDatasource.components?.MetadataInspector) {
return <Trans id="dashboard.inspect-meta.no-inspector">No Metadata Inspector</Trans>;
return <Trans i18nKey="dashboard.inspect-meta.no-inspector">No Metadata Inspector</Trans>;
}
return <metadataDatasource.components.MetadataInspector datasource={metadataDatasource} data={data.series} />;
};